## Safe Lock Replacement — Transport Note

The replacement lock assembly for the Varnholt vault safe ships Tuesday via Keldrin Secure Transit. Package is sealed and tamper-taped at the Ostermark depot. Do not open before the fitter from Branlow Locksmiths arrives on site. Sign the transit slip in duplicate. The courier will require the hand-over phrase before releasing the crate.

handover note for bajog-tawig: the lamion quenael courier leaves the wendor ledger at gate 1289 under passcode 760784

**Internal Memo — Dispatch Desk: Q2 Stock-Count Ledger Transfer**

The quarterly stock-count ledger for the Fernhollow warehouse has been reconciled, countersigned, and sealed in tamper-evident wrap by the inventory team. It must travel as a single item — no pouching with routine mail — and remain in the courier's possession for the entire run to the Aldercote records office. Record the seal number on the manifest and obtain a timed signature at both ends. The confidential hand-over instruction for the courier appears directly below this line.

handover note for yagef-bagep: the drudor pelius courier leaves the kasdor zorvan norir ledger at gate 8016 under passcode 755406

Handover: billing worker deploys

The Corvane billing worker ships via blue-green. Green gets traffic only after the invoice-reconciliation smoke test passes; never skip it, even for config-only changes. Cutover is manual by design — billing jobs are not idempotent across versions. Keep blue warm for 24 hours in case of rollback. Full procedure, including the rollback checklist and past incident notes, is on the page below.

wiki page, tagef-bajog: https://grafana.nelvrocorp.corp/projects/pages/display/fa238a928afe